New Beginnings and Fresh Starts

Baby chicks, with their fluffy down and hesitant steps, are quintessential symbols of new beginnings and fresh starts. Their emergence from the egg represents the potential for growth and the vulnerability of nascent life, mirroring the fragile yet exciting nature of a new venture or chapter in your life. Dreaming of a baby chick suggests that you are on the cusp of something new, perhaps a new project, relationship, or phase of personal development. The tiny chick's struggle to walk and find its footing symbolizes the initial challenges and uncertainties you might encounter as you embark on this new path. However, the chick's inherent drive to survive and thrive also emphasizes your own inner resilience and potential for success. The dream encourages you to embrace the possibilities that lie ahead, even if they feel daunting at first. Just as the chick eventually grows into a strong hen or rooster, the dream suggests that your own efforts will bear fruit in due time, leading to a fulfilling and rewarding outcome. If the baby chick in your dream is healthy and active, it signifies a positive and promising start. Conversely, a sick or injured chick might suggest that you need to nurture and protect this new endeavor, ensuring it has the support and resources it needs to flourish.

Clucking Clues: A Peep into the Cultural History of Baby Chicks in Dreams

Have you ever dreamt of a tiny, fluffy chick?

What did it do?

What did it look like?

Across cultures, the humble chick holds surprisingly varied symbolic weight.

In many ancient societies, the chick symbolized new beginnings.

Think of the spring equinox. Think of rebirth.

The egg cracking open. A fresh start.

This association with new life is remarkably consistent.

From the fertile crescent to the Far East, the chick represented hope. Hope for a bountiful harvest. Hope for a thriving family.

However, the symbolism isn't always sunshine and rainbows.

Some cultures viewed chicks as fragile. Vulnerable. In need of protection.

This could reflect anxieties about future prospects. Or fears for loved ones.

Consider the chick's inherent dependence. Its reliance on its mother hen.

This might mirror feelings of helplessness or a need for nurturing in the dreamer's waking life.

Interestingly, certain Christian traditions associate the chick with resurrection.

A new life emerging from the shell. Echoes of Christ's rebirth.

The interpretation therefore depends heavily on the individual's cultural background. And their personal beliefs.

Exploring these diverse perspectives unveils a deeper understanding of the chick's potent symbolism. In the realm of dreams.
